Settings specific to TRANSMIT
Type of transformation
The following paragraph describes how the transformation type is specified.
TRAFO_TYPE_n
The user must specify the transformation type for the transformation data blocks (maximum
n = 10). The value 256 must be set for TRANSMIT or the VALUE 257 for a rotary axis with
supplementary linear axis.
Example for VALUE 256: MD24100 $MC_TRAFO_TYPE_1=256
The setting must be made before TRANSMIT or TRANSMIT(t) is called, where "t" is the
number of the declared TRANSMIT transformation.
The TRANSMIT transformation requires only a rotary axis and a linear axis positioned
perpendicular to the rotary axis. A real Y axis is used with transformation type 257 in order to
compensate for a tool offset, for example.
Transformation type 257
Polar transformation with a rotary axis TRAFO_TYPE_n = 25710.04
Transformation with supplementary linear axis
If the machine has another linear axis which is perpendicular to both the rotary axis and the
first linear axis, transformation type 257 can be used to apply tool offsets with the real Y axis.
It is assumed that the working area of the second linear axis is small and is not to be used
for the retraction of the part program.
The existing settings for MD24120 $MC_TRAFO_GEOAX_ASSIGN_TAB_n apply.
